Definition and Technology of Smart Coatings


Smart coatings are distinguished from conventional coatings by their ability to interact with environmental stimuli, offering features such as self-healing, antimicrobial properties, corrosion resistance, and dynamic optical changes. They utilize advanced materials, including nanoparticles, microencapsulated agents, and biomimetic structures, enabling surfaces to adapt, respond, or actively interact with their surroundings. The technology draws from nanotechnology, polymer chemistry, surface engineering, and materials science, allowing precise manipulation of molecular and nanoscale structures to achieve tailored properties. Unlike standard coatings, smart coatings actively engage with their environment, providing enhanced durability, safety, and functionality.

Key Market Trends


A significant trend in smart coatings is the development of bio-inspired and biomimetic coatings. Researchers are designing coatings that mimic natural mechanisms, such as lotus leaf self-cleaning, shark skin anti-fouling, and butterfly wing color-changing nanostructures. These coatings provide enhanced performance while meeting sustainability goals, reducing chemical use, and offering applications in architecture, transportation, and consumer products. Another trend involves multifunctional hybrid coatings, which combine multiple smart features such as self-healing, anti-corrosion, anti-fouling, and UV protection into a single system. These coatings simplify application, reduce costs, and enhance performance, particularly in aerospace and automotive industries.

Type Insights


Self-healing coatings currently hold the largest market share, extensively used in automotive, aerospace, marine, and industrial sectors. These coatings repair surface damage automatically through microencapsulated healing agents or reversible polymer networks, extending surface life and maintaining aesthetics. The automotive industry drives strong demand by preserving paint quality, reducing warranty claims, and maintaining resale value. Aerospace applications benefit from reduced maintenance costs and extended intervals between recoating. Anti-microbial coatings are expected to grow at the fastest rate due to heightened awareness of hygiene, particularly post-pandemic, and are widely applied in healthcare and public spaces to prevent infections.

Technology Insights


Nanotechnology-based coatings dominate the smart coatings market, offering precise control over molecular-level properties. Nanoparticles provide self-cleaning, UV protection, enhanced mechanical strength, and antimicrobial functions. Nanostructured surfaces can create superhydrophobic or superoleophobic properties, while carbon-based nanomaterials enhance electrical conductivity and mechanical durability. Nano-encapsulation protects reactive compounds until activated by damage. Continuous innovation in nanotechnology and material formulation supports ongoing growth and expanded applications for smart coatings.

Application Insights


The automotive sector accounts for the largest application share, driven by the industry’s focus on aesthetics, durability, and advanced features. Self-healing coatings maintain paint quality, hydrophobic coatings improve visibility and reduce cleaning, and anti-corrosion coatings extend component life. Electric and autonomous vehicle development creates further demand for protective coatings. The healthcare sector is projected to grow fastest, fueled by infection prevention concerns, aging populations requiring medical devices, and expanding healthcare infrastructure. Regulatory approvals for antimicrobial coatings accelerate adoption in hospitals, medical facilities, and public spaces.

End User Insights


Automotive OEMs represent the largest end-user segment due to high production volumes, premium vehicle lines, and collaboration with coating suppliers. OEMs integrate smart coatings during manufacturing to ensure optimal performance and longevity. Medical device manufacturers are expected to grow fastest, driven by infection prevention, extended device lifespan, and innovative solutions to clinical challenges. The premium nature of medical devices supports the adoption of smart coatings despite higher costs, as performance and safety benefits outweigh price considerations.

Regional Insights


North America leads the smart coatings market with a 38-42% share, driven by research and development investments, collaboration between coating manufacturers and industrial players, strong regulatory frameworks, and a consumer base willing to pay for high-performance coatings. Asia Pacific is expected to grow the fastest due to rapid industrialization, expanding automotive production, infrastructure development, and government initiatives promoting sustainable coatings. Lower manufacturing costs and technological innovation in the region also facilitate market growth, supporting applications in marine, renewable energy, and electronics sectors.

Market Opportunities and Challenges


The market faces challenges from high initial costs and limited awareness. Smart coatings often cost several times more than traditional coatings due to complex materials and manufacturing processes, deterring cost-sensitive customers. Technical complexity and evolving certification processes can also limit adoption. However, expanding applications in healthcare, automotive, and industrial sectors, coupled with technological innovation, present significant growth opportunities. Coatings that reduce maintenance, extend product lifespan, and provide enhanced performance offer long-term value despite higher upfront costs.
